Thirty-three charged with trespassing after University of Washington building takeover

yahoo.com

Thirty-three individuals face misdemeanor trespassing charges for occupying the University of Washington's engineering building during a pro-Palestinian protest. Prosecutors cited insufficient evidence to identify those responsible for the estimated $1 million in damages, preventing felony charges. Arraignments are set for March 25. The protest, organized by SUPER UW, demanded the university sever ties with Boeing due to its defense industry involvement.
